Fire Weather Planning Forecast for Southern New England
National Weather Service Boston/Norton MA
409 PM EST Thu Nov 20 2025

.DISCUSSION...

Mainly dry weather prevails through Friday, other than a slight
risk for some late day showers around the Vineyard and Nantucket.
Increasing risk for showers Friday night as a cold front crosses
our region. Not looking like a wetting rain is likely.

Minimum relative humidity values between 45 and 65 percent are
expected for Friday.

.OUTLOOK...Saturday through Thursday...

Dry weather returns late Saturday into Monday night as high
pressure builds into the region. Next chance for rainfall looks
to be sometime from late Tuesday into Thursday as a pair of low
pressures impact southern New England.
